The SS Edmund Fitzgerald is a spooky sunken ship story. In 1975, this huge ore carrier sank in Lake Superior during a storm. The ship was known for being very sturdy, but it was no match for the powerful waves. All 29 crew members perished. There are tales of strange noises heard in the area where it sank, as if the ship was still trying to make its journey. And then there's the Lusitania. It was torpedoed by a German U - boat during World War I. The suddenness of the attack and the chaos that ensued as the ship quickly filled with water and sank was truly horrifying. Hundreds of lives were lost in that disaster.
